Auxiliary tool for cable maintenance
Technical Field
The utility model relates to the technical field of cables, specifically be an appurtenance is used in cable maintenance.
Background
In the cable maintenance and salvage in-process, the ladder is one of the most commonly used instrument, and current ladder generally only climbs this kind of function of height, but the maintainer is climbing ladder top when overhauing, the ladder bottom sprag is on ground, the top sprag is in one side of wire pole, the ladder bottom is receiving under the exogenic action on every side, can cause the ladder to rock, cause the maintenance workman to follow the shake together, cause the maintenance workman when overhauing the cable, the stability of ladder is relatively poor, for this reason, provide an appurtenance for the cable maintenance.
SUMMERY OF THE UTILITY MODEL
An object of the utility model is to provide an appurtenance is used in cable maintenance to solve the problem that proposes among the above-mentioned background art.
In order to achieve the above object, the utility model provides a following technical scheme: an auxiliary tool for cable maintenance comprises a first ladder frame, wherein a second ladder frame is arranged on the lower side of the first ladder frame, a self-locking hinge is hinged to one side of the second ladder frame, one side of the self-locking hinge is hinged to one side of the first ladder frame, and a stabilizing assembly is arranged on one side of the second ladder frame;
the stabilizing assembly comprises a fixing frame and a pedal, first sliding grooves are formed in the inner side of the second ladder stand respectively, sliding rails are fixed on the inner side walls of the first sliding grooves, the inner sides of the sliding rails are connected to one side of the pedal in a sliding mode, first springs are connected between the bottom of the pedal and the inner side walls of the first sliding grooves, a plurality of conical rods are fixed to the bottom of the pedal, and second sliding grooves are formed in the fixing frame.
As a further preferred aspect of the present invention: the inner side of the second sliding groove is connected with a sliding plate in a sliding mode, one side of the sliding plate is fixedly provided with a sliding column which movably penetrates through one side of the fixing frame, and one side of the sliding column is fixedly provided with a pushing block.
As a further preferred aspect of the present invention: one side of the sliding plate is respectively fixed with a locking block and a baffle plate, a second spring is connected between one side of the sliding plate and the inner side wall of the second sliding groove, and one side of the locking block and the baffle plate movably penetrates through one side of the second ladder climbing frame.
As further preferable in the present technical solution: one side of the fixing frame is fixed on one side of the second ladder climbing frame, and the pedal is cuboid.
As a further preferred aspect of the present invention: a first supporting block is fixed on one side of the top of the first ladder stand, a second supporting block is fixed on the other side of the top of the first ladder stand, and a first tool box is fixed on one side of the first supporting block.
As a further preferred aspect of the present invention: one side of the second supporting block is rotatably connected with a fixed pulley through a bearing, the outer side of the fixed pulley is wound with a rope, and a pulling block and a second tool box are fixed at two ends of the rope respectively.
Compared with the prior art, the beneficial effects of the utility model are that:
the ladder stand is moved to the lower side of a cable to be overhauled, a maintenance worker firstly steps on the top of the pedal by one foot, the pedal slides in the inner sides of the sliding rail and the first sliding groove, a plurality of conical rods at the bottom are obliquely inserted into soil, the stability of the ladder stand in use is improved, and the risk that the ladder stand falls off due to the fact that the ladder is shaken is reduced.
When the cable is overhauled, partial tools are placed on the inner side of the first tool box, the phenomenon that a maintenance worker carries too many tools to cause too much burden on a body is avoided, materials are placed inside the second tool box, the pulling block and the rope can lift the materials located inside the second tool box to the top of the first ladder stand under the action of rotation of the fixed pulley, and the cable is conveniently maintained by the maintenance worker.

Examples
Referring to fig. 1-3, the present invention provides a technical solution: an auxiliary tool for cable maintenance comprises a first ladder frame 1, wherein a second ladder frame 4 is arranged on the lower side of the first ladder frame 1, a self-locking hinge 3 is hinged to one side of the second ladder frame 4, one side of the self-locking hinge 3 is hinged to one side of the first ladder frame 1, and a stabilizing component 2 is arranged on one side of the second ladder frame 4;
the stabilizing component 2 comprises a fixed frame 23 and a pedal 210, a first sliding groove 26 is respectively arranged on the inner side of the second ladder frame 4, a sliding rail 28 is fixed on the inner side wall of the first sliding groove 26, the inner side of the rail groove of the sliding rail 28 is connected to one side of the pedal 210 in a sliding manner, a first spring 27 is connected between the bottom of the pedal 210 and the inner side wall of the first sliding groove 26, a worker firstly steps on the top of the pedal 210 by using one foot, so that the pedal 210 slides on the inner sides of the sliding rail 28 and the first sliding groove 26, meanwhile, the first spring 27 is stressed and compressed, a plurality of tapered rods 29 are fixed at the bottom of the pedal 210, a second sliding groove 212 is arranged inside the fixed frame 23, so that the plurality of tapered rods 29 fixed at the bottom of the pedal 210 are obliquely inserted into soil, the stability of the ladder in use is improved, the risk of falling caused by external force when the maintenance worker uses the ladder is reduced, and the tool is suitable for the soil ground on the lower side of the cable, a sliding plate 211 is slidably connected to the inner side of the second sliding groove 212, a sliding post 21 movably penetrating through one side of the fixing frame 23 is fixed to one side of the sliding plate 211, a push block 22 is fixed to one side of the sliding plate 21, a locking block 24 and a baffle 25 are respectively fixed to one side of the sliding plate 211, a second spring 213 is connected between one side of the sliding plate 211 and the inner side wall of the second sliding groove 212, one sides of the locking block 24 and the baffle 25 movably penetrate through one side of the second ladder climbing frame 4, only the push block 22 needs to be pulled to one side, the sliding post 21 is driven to move to one side, the sliding plate 211 slides to the inner side of the second sliding groove 212 under the action of the sliding post 21, the locking block 24 and the baffle 25 move to one side along with the push block 22, the bottom of the locking block 24 leaves one side of the top of the pedal 210, at this time, the pedal 210 slides to the inner side of the track groove of the sliding rail 28 under the action of the first spring 27, one side of the fixing frame 23 is fixed to one side of the second ladder frame 4, the pedal 210 has a rectangular parallelepiped shape.
First 1 top one side of ladder frame is fixed with first supporting shoe 6, 1 top opposite side of first ladder frame is fixed with second supporting shoe 8, 6 one side of first supporting shoe is fixed with first toolbox 5, place some instruments in first toolbox 5 inboardly, avoid the maintenance workman to carry too much instrument, cause the health burden too big, 8 one side of second supporting shoe is connected with fixed pulley 9 through the bearing rotation, the wiring in the 9 outside of fixed pulley has rope 10, the both ends of rope 10 are fixed with respectively and draw piece 7 and second toolbox 11, under fixed pulley 9 pivoted effect, the material that will be located 11 insides of second toolbox risees first ladder frame 1 top, make things convenient for the maintenance workman to maintain the cable.
The working principle is as follows: when a maintenance worker overhauls a cable, the first ladder frame 1 and the second ladder frame 4 are moved to the lower side of the cable, the self-locking hinge 3 is opened at the moment, so that the first ladder frame 1 and the second ladder frame 4 are in a vertical state, in order to prevent the maintenance worker from shaking when the maintenance worker uses the first ladder frame 1 and the second ladder frame 4, the maintenance worker drops from the first ladder frame 1 and the second ladder frame 4 to cause body damage, before the maintenance worker needs to climb the first ladder frame 1 and the second ladder frame 4, the maintenance worker firstly steps on the top of the pedal 210 by one foot, the pedal 210 slides on the inner sides of the sliding rails 28 and the first sliding grooves 26, meanwhile, the first spring 27 is compressed under the stress, the pedal 210 passes through a guide inclined plane on one side of the locking block 24 at the moment, the pedal 210 passes over one side of the top of the locking block 24, at the moment, under the effect of the first spring 27, the pedal 210 is abutted against one side of the bottom of the locking block 24, a plurality of conical rods are inserted into the bottom of the locking block 210 at the moment, the cable, the external force is applied to reduce the risk of the use of the maintenance worker when the cable, and the maintenance worker falls off the ground;
when the ladder stand is used by a maintenance worker, the push block 22 only needs to be pulled to one side, the sliding column 21 is driven to move to one side, under the action of the sliding column 21, the sliding plate 211 slides to the inner side of the second sliding groove 212, meanwhile, the locking block 24 and the baffle plate 25 move to one side along with the push block 22, the bottom of the locking block 24 leaves one side of the top of the pedal 210, at the moment, under the action of the first spring 27, the pedal 210 slides to the inner side of the rail groove of the sliding rail 28, meanwhile, the top of the pedal 210 is abutted to the bottom of the baffle plate 25, and stability is increased when the ladder stand is used next time.
Meanwhile, when the ladder is used, part of tools can be placed inside the first tool box 5, the fact that too many tools are carried by maintenance workers is avoided, the body burden is too large, when cables take materials needing to be overhauled, the workers only need to be placed inside the second tool box 11 by the lower side workers, the maintenance workers located at the top of the first ladder frame 1 only need to pull the pull block 7 and the rope 10, the materials located inside the second tool box 11 can be lifted to the top of the first ladder frame 1 under the rotating effect of the fixed pulley 9, and the maintenance workers can maintain the cables conveniently.
